How Much Does a Master’s in Taxation from UW Seattle Cost?

$17,394 Average Tuition and Fees

UW Seattle Gradu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time graduate students at UW Seattle paid an average of $1,389 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$775 per credit hour. The average full-time tuition and fees for graduate students are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$16,278$29,178
Fees$1,116$1,116

Does UW Seattle Offer an Online Master’s in Taxation?

UW Seattle does not offer an online option for its taxation master’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the UW Seattle Online Learning page.

UW Seattle Master’s Student Diversity for Taxation

41 Master's Degrees Awarded
68.3% Women
39.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 41 students received their master’s degree in taxation.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 68.3% of the students who received their Master’s in taxation in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 50.5%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 39.0% of the taxation master’s degrees at UW Seattle in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 33%.

undefined
Race/EthnicityNumber of Students
Asian13
Black or African American0
Hispanic or Latino2
Native American or Alaska Native0
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ander0
White19
International Students4
Other Races/Ethnicities3
